Transaction 6620651a164a208fd13e3492bb1a89b011fa1bf3cfaf1fb91896a65e04ad261c
1 Input
1 Output
-
6620651a164a208fd13e3492bb1a89b011fa1bf3cfaf1fb91896a65e04ad261c:0
- value
- 55954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 721e0cf512d67cc0d90ced47a38cbeb731a7b2ee OP_EQUAL
- address
- 3C6QxNAYeGtw3eTC5fmhdKmwQLzYJGJeFL